    Default LSD from pintara?

    hey guys,

    ok, the rhumor i heard...
    "the diff gears in the automatic nissan pintara are always either 3.9, or 4.11..... and that they fit straight into the diff of a VH commodore."

    now, question 1 is, would i have a sailsbury, or a borg warner? its a discs rear end 253, non lsd.

    and secondly, is the rhumor true?

    and thirdly, has anyone done this?

    Yeah early skylines, falcons etc all had a 78 series borgwarner diff, crown & pinion will bolt into a commodore, you just need to check axel splines. Most run a 25spline diff centre which will slot straight into a standard borgwarner diff. the 25 pline LSD centres are a 2pinion LSD which are still pretty good but there is as usual something better. If you get a 28 spline centre out of a VL diff or VN-VS it runs a 4 pinion LSD centre and is much stronger even the IRS still run the same centre. But you will need to get yourself a pair of axels to suit your diff housing thats where it will get expensive. up to $600 kind of expensive.

    Oh an yes i have play with a diff from an early skyline that had 3.9 gears.

    Manual Skyline - 3.7
    Auto Skyline - 3.9
    Manual Pintara - 3.9
    Auto Pintara - 4.11

    VH have a sals, you'll need a BorgWarner from late VK or VL.
    Late VK 6Cyl, VL na 6Cyl BW 25 spline
    VL V8, VL Turbo AND VN - VS BW 28 spline

    You need the Borgwarner housing and axles from a VL turbo or V8 commodore, and a Borgwarner center from a pintara or skyline.
